Nordic Misty modules are designed to be free-standing or connected to your Nordic Misty Sauna or any other Nordic Misty module. With endless possibilities, your outdoor oasis is yours to create and personalize. Modules and saunas do not have to be ordered together, giving you the flexibility to grow your collection over time.
Ensure a clear, accessible path from the delivery point to the final placement site. All modules should be installed on a firm, level surface such as concrete, decking, pavers, or compacted gravel.
When ordering a lounge, it’s important to confirm the sauna door’s opening direction and understand how it can be adjusted when attaching the lounge. The lounge comes with wider cover boards that replace the sauna’s existing ones (refer to the provided instructions for changing the cover boards). Customers can modify the sauna door’s opening direction if desired. Additionally, a connecting plate is included to securely attach the sauna to the lounge.
The lounge roof matches the design of the Nordic Misty Sauna, ensuring a seamless connection. Both structures must be placed on the same level and attached using the transport brackets. Wider cover plates are installed around the door between the sauna and lounge to conceal the transition, while a wider U-profile sheet secures the roof to the intermediate walls for a polished, cohesive finish.

Shipping free from WellnessHydro. Outdoor saunas are delivered via flatbed trailer and fully assembled.
Customers are notified two weeks prior to the scheduled delivery to allow time for preparation. A forklift or crane is required for unloading this unit. Due to its size and weight, manual offloading is not recommended. Please ensure the proper equipment is available at the time of delivery.
Please ensure you are fully prepared to receive and unload your sauna in accordance with the instructions provided in your manual.
Thermasol outdoor saunas are delivered fully assembled. A forklift or crane is required for placement, and a licensed electrician must install the heater.
The path from delivery point to placement site must be clear and accessible for equipment. Saunas should be installed on a firm, level surface with slight runoff for drainage—such as concrete, decking, pavers, or compacted gravel.

Traditional (Finnish) Saunas: Typically operate between 150°F and 190°F (65--88°C), with a median standard between 165--180°F.
Infrared Saunas: Operate at lower, radiant heat temperatures, generally between 120°F and 150°F.
Beginners: Start with 10 to 15 minutes per session.
Advanced: You can stay longer (up to 20 minutes), but it is best done in "innings". Do a 15-minute session, exit to cool down and rehydrate for 5 minutes, and then return for another round. Always listen to your body and exit immediately if you feel dizzy or nauseous.
This is a matter of personal preference. Traditional saunas use heated rocks where you can add water to create steam and instantly increase the humidity. Infrared saunas are run dry without rocks or steam. You can also add essential oils to your water for aromatherapy.
Before: Yes, shower beforehand to rinse off perfumes, lotions, and oils to keep the sauna sanitary and help your skin sweat freely.
After: Yes, rinse off the sweat, salts, and toxins, and help your pores close back up.

Traditional Saunas: Heat the air in the room to high temperatures using electric or wood-burning heaters.
Infrared Saunas: Use invisible light spectrum wavelengths to heat your body directly rather than superheating the surrounding air.
- Proper ventilation is critical so you don't sit in a "suffocation box" with depleted oxygen and high CO₂ buildup. A well-designed traditional sauna has an intake vent near the floor by the heater and an exhaust vent on the opposite wall.
Sauna therapy is generally safe, but you should consult a doctor first if you have underlying cardiovascular conditions, take certain medications, or are pregnant. Never use a sauna if you have a fever, are under the influence of alcohol, or feel lightheaded.
